Free Tickets Available for 2016 High Holiday Services Near Nyack

at participating synagogues in Rockland County

WEST NYACK, NY, – Free tickets to High Holiday services at Rockland County Board of Rabbis’ synagogues are now available to qualifying households, Jewish Federation & Foundation of Rockland County officials announced.

Tickets are available for Erev Rosh Hashanah, Rosh Hashanah Day 1, Rosh Hashanah Day 2, Kol Nidre and Yom Kippur.

The free ticket offer is made possible by the Rockland Jewish Initiative (RJI), a program of the Jewish Federation. Cantor Barry Kanarek, Director of the Rockland Jewish Initiative is administering the program.

“This is the third year that Federation has partnered with the Rockland County Board of Rabbis to offer free High Holiday tickets," Kanarek said. "Our goal is to make it easy for families who might be new to the area – or new to Judaism – to celebrate our most important holy days as part of a congregation.”

To qualify for the free tickets, applicants must not have been a member of a Rockland County Board of Rabbis synagogue for the past two years or purchased High Holiday tickets in Rockland County for the past two years.
